We have studied the hyperfine interactions in samples belonging to the Fe-Sesystem. Several samples with various concentrations of selenium were synthesized and investigated. The objective was to find synthesis conditions increasing the concentration of a secondary Fe-Se phase with a rather large quadrupole splitting of∼1.7 mm/s. At Tm ≈104 K this secondary phase undergoes a magnetic ordering.
